Significance of Nourishment in Back Pain
Nutrition plays a vital function in handling back pain. Your diet plan can considerably affect swelling degrees and total discomfort levels in your back. Eating a balanced diet abundant in nutrients like vitamins D and K, calcium, magnesium, and omega-3 fats can help reduce inflammation and enhance bones, which are vital for back health.
Additionally, maintaining a healthy weight through proper nutrition can minimize stress on your spine, decreasing the danger of pain in the back.
Furthermore, particular nutrients like antioxidants found in fruits and vegetables can aid combat oxidative stress and advertise healing in the body, including the back muscles and back.
On the other hand, taking in too much quantities of refined foods, sugary drinks, and harmful fats can contribute to inflammation and weight gain, aggravating pain in the back.
Foods to Eat for Back Health And Wellness
To support a healthy back, including nutrient-rich foods into your daily dishes is key. Including foods high in antioxidants like berries, spinach, and kale can help reduce swelling in your back, alleviating discomfort and pain. Omega-3 fats discovered in fatty fish such as salmon and mackerel have anti-inflammatory buildings that can benefit your back health.
In addition, taking in nuts and seeds like almonds, walnuts, and chia seeds provides vital nutrients like magnesium and vitamin E, which sustain muscle mass feature and reduce oxidative tension. Integrating lean healthy proteins such as hen, turkey, and tofu can assist in muscular tissue repair and upkeep, advertising a solid back.
Do not fail to remember to consist of dairy or strengthened plant-based choices for calcium to sustain bone health and wellness. Lastly, hydrate with a lot of water to maintain your spine discs hydrated and working ideally. By consisting of these nutrient-dense foods in your diet plan, you can nurture your back and assistance total spinal wellness.
Foods to Avoid for Back Pain
Opt for preventing processed foods high in sugarcoated and trans fats when seeking remedy for pain in the back. These sorts of foods can contribute to inflammation in the body, which might intensify back pain. Say no to sugary treats sweet, breads, and sugary beverages, as well as convenience food items like hamburgers, french fries, and fried hen that are usually filled with trans fats.
Additionally, stay away from foods containing high degrees of polished carbs, such as white bread, pasta, and breads, as they can increase blood glucose degrees and possibly intensify inflammation in the body.
It's additionally smart to restrict your consumption of foods high in hydrogenated fats, like red meat and full-fat dairy products, as they can contribute to swelling. Refined foods like delicatessens meats, chips, and packaged snacks are often high in hydrogenated fats and ought to be eaten in small amounts.
